When the host system has asciidoctor and po4a/poman installed,
util-linux detect them and automatically enable manual pages and
their translations. This can significantly increase the package
build time (in my case, from 20s to 1m50s). See upstream
commit [1] and [2].
Since manual pages are not needed in Buildroot, this commit adds in
_CONF_OPTS for host host and target variants the options to always
disable the detection of those programs (--disable-asciidoc
--disable-poman). This will always disable the generation of manual
pages.
Note: Buildroot attempts to globally disable documentation for
autotools packages by passing various --disable-docs configure
options (see [3]), but those are not recognized by util-linux.
This commit also reorder the options for UTIL_LINUX_CONF_OPTS.
